Electrochemotherapy for cutaneous tumors combined with tumor irradiation before or after treatment: feasibility, safety, and effectiveness
Abstract
Background. Electrochemotherapy (ECT) can be performed on tumors in patients that precedes tumor irra-diation or on recurrent tumors after tumor irradiation. In this study we evaluated the feasibility, safety and effectiveness of the combined ECT and tumor irradiation (radiotherapy – RT) on different tumors in the head and neck region.
Patients and methods. For the present cohort analysis, patients were selected from the Insp-ECT database, based on the following criteria: presence of head and neck lesions of any histological origin, treatment with both ECT and RT in any sequence, and a maximum interval of 12 months between the two treatments. The patients were treated with RT as before ECT (ECT → RT) or ECT as before RT (RT → ECT), in both cases because the first treatment resulted in non-complete response. In the case of ECT → RT the time interval was 5.3 months and in the case of RT → ECT 7.6 months. The minimal time interval between the treatments was 1 month.
Results. Treatment with ECT with bleomycin was feasible in all patients, treated either before or after RT. Included were 37 patients with the head and neck lesions. The combined treatment was performed predomi-nantly on older population of patients with the age range from 59 to 96 years, median over 80 years. Im-portantly, in the group ECT → RT the major reason for RT was partial response (67%) after ECT. While, in the RT → ECT group the major reason for subsequent ECT was 58% of stable or progressive disease (failure to treatment). In both groups local symptoms decreased, like ulceration, odour and suppuration of tumors. In the ECT → RT group, the short-term response after 2 months was high, with 88% objective responses. In contrast, the RT → ECT group had a significantly lower rate, with 58% objective responses. Long-term re-sponses, measured at 2-years follow-up by progression-free survival, were also significantly higher in the ECT → RT group (68%) compared to the RT → ECT group (20%). This resulted also in significantly higher overall progression free survival in ECT → RT group (p = 0.0232).
Conclusions. The combined treatment of ECT and RT is feasible, safe, and effective in elderly patients. The findings suggest that ECT may have particular value as a neoadjuvant treatment before RT, especially for bulky, ulcerated, or symptomatic lesions in this population.
